Solenostoma rubrum - Perianth with tear from capsule emerging through small mouth. Lane Co., Oregon. DHW m2808


4a Dioicous; erect fertile shoots often reddish-tinged (but not rhizoids); flagellate branches frequent; oil bodies notably diverse, either 2-3 large, fusiform ones per cell (most common) or else more numerous, smaller ones; abundant on bare soil at low to middle elevations in Western Oregon
Solenostoma rubrum


4b Paroicous; shoot and rhizoids pale; flagellate branches uncommon; oil bodies various, usually 6-9 per cell; rare
Solenostoma confertissimum or Solenostoma sphaerocarpum
